A traffic accident occurred in Marktoberdorf on Tuesday afternoon, resulting in the injury of a cyclist after a failure to yield at a roundabout. The incident took place at the intersection of Johann-Georg-Fendt-Straße and Bahnhofstraße, a busy area frequented by both motorists and cyclists.
According to information from local authorities, an 18-year-old woman was driving her vehicle northbound along Bahnhofstraße. As she approached the roundabout, she entered without granting right of way to a 45-year-old man who was traveling through the roundabout on his bicycle. The resulting collision led to the cyclist being struck by the car.
Emergency services responded promptly to the scene. The injured cyclist sustained minor injuries and received immediate medical attention from paramedics at the location. He was subsequently transported by ambulance to a nearby hospital for further examination and treatment. The extent of his injuries was described as non-life-threatening, and he remained under observation for potential complications.
Both the car and the bicycle sustained damages as a result of the accident. Police estimated the total property damage at approximately 1,500 euros. The authorities have initiated an official investigation into the circumstances surrounding the incident, focusing primarily on the failure to yield the right of way at the roundabout, which is a common cause of accidents in such traffic environments.
Roundabouts are designed to improve traffic flow and enhance safety at intersections, but accidents can still occur, particularly when traffic rules are not strictly observed. Local law enforcement emphasized the importance of adhering to traffic regulations, especially yielding to all vehicles already in the roundabout, regardless of whether they are motorized or non-motorized. This rule is critical for the safety of all road users, including cyclists, who are often at greater risk of injury in the event of a collision.
Authorities have reminded both drivers and cyclists to remain vigilant and cautious, especially at intersections and roundabouts where visibility may be limited and the actions of other road users can be unpredictable. The police are reviewing available evidence and witness statements to determine whether further legal action will be taken against the motorist involved in the incident.
